  • Publication number: 20210344196
    Abstract: Provided are method and device for adjusting a power flow based on operation constraints. The method includes: establishing a power flow adjusting model comprising an objective function and constraints; acquiring active power and reactive power of each node by using a two-stage optimization of active and reactive powers. In this method, the power flow adjusting model is divided into the active power optimization sub-model and the reactive power optimization sub-model. The active power optimization sub-model, where the linearized power flow constraint and the tie line section active power constraint are considered, may be regarded as quadratic programming. The reactive power flow optimization sub-model is solved on the basis of the active sub-model, and the AC power flow constraint, the grid voltage range constraint, and the pilot bus voltage setting value constraint are considered.

  • Patent number: 11043818
    Abstract: The disclosure provides a stochastic look-ahead dispatch method for power system based on Newton method, belonging to power system dispatch technologies. The disclosure analyzes historical data of wind power output, and uses statistical or fitting software to perform Gaussian mixture model fitting. A dispatch model with chance constraints is established for system parameters. Newton method is to solve quantiles of random variables obeying Gaussian mixture model, so that chance constraints are transformed into deterministic linear constraints, thus transforming original problem to convex optimization problem with linear constraints. Finally, the model is solved to obtain look-ahead dispatch. The disclosure employs Newton method to transform chance constraints containing risk level and random variables into deterministic linear constraints, which effectively improves model solution efficiency, and provides reasonable dispatch for decision makers.

  • Patent number: 10923916
    Abstract: The disclosure provides a stochastic dynamical unit commitment method for power system based on solving quantiles via Newton method, belonging to power system technologies. The method establishes a unit commitment model with chance constraints for power system parameters. Quantiles of random variables obeying mixed Gaussian distribution is solved by Newton method, and chance constraints are transformed into deterministic linear constraints, so that original problem is transformed into mixed integer linear optimization problem. Finally, the model is solved to obtain on-off strategy and active power plan of units. The disclosure employs Newton method to transform chance constraints containing risk level and random variables into deterministic mixed integer linear constraints, which effectively improves the model solution efficiency, eliminates conservative nature of conventional robust unit commitment, provides reasonable dispatch basis for decision makers.

  • Patent number: 10673237
    Abstract: A reactive power optimization method for integrated transmission and distribution networks related to a field of operation and control technology of an electric power system is provided. The reactive power optimization method includes: establishing a reactive power optimization model for a transmission and distribution network consisting of a transmission network and a plurality of distribution networks, in which the reactive power optimization model includes an objective function and a plurality of constraints; performing a second order cone relaxation on a non-convex constraint of a plurality of distribution network constraints of the plurality of constraints; and solving the reactive power optimization model by using a generalized Benders decomposition method so as to control each generator in the transmission network and each generator in the plurality of distribution networks.
